Narrative:

We asked and received clearance to push back from gate. We repeated our call sign and the fact that we were given clearance after we were given clearance for the push. Ground was asked by a jet why we were in the alley as he was trying to turn in. Ground responded that she did not know and asked us who we were. We responded with our call sign and that she had given us clearance to push. She responded that she did not remember giving her clearance and I responded with my call sign when it was given. No further comment was made about the incident by ground and the rest of the flight was uneventful.
